The correct answer should be the morality play. They would usually feature various personified emotions, beliefs, values, and a protagonist would meet them and achieve something greater with their help.

Macbeth, which shows the theme of corruption is how Macbeth is plotting to kill his best friend, Banquo. Macbeths power and ambition to become king leads to fear, doubt and lack of trust between Banquo and himself which leads to the isolation of Macbeth from god, his friends and his society.
